How to Safeguard Data in Outsourcing

Offshoring, the process of outsourcing business operations to a third-party provider abroad, has become a common practice among companies worldwide. It can help organizations boost efficiency levels. However, there is one significant concern associated with offshoring: potential threats.
In today's digital age, data security is a top priority for businesses, especially when dealing with sensitive information such as customer data. When offshoring, companies expose themselves to various data security risks, including cyber attacks.
To ensure data security in offshoring, companies must take proactive measures to protect themselves and their clients. Here are some steps they can take:
1 Establish data protection protocols: The first step is to identify what data needs to be protected and determine the level of security required. This includes assessing the sensitivity of the data and the probability of a breach.
2 Evaluate offshoring partners: Research potential offshoring providers to assess their data security policies and procedures. Look for providers that have experience in handling sensitive data and have implemented robust security measures to protect it.
3 Negotiate contract terms carefully: When negotiating a contract with an offshoring provider, ensure that the terms and conditions meet your data security requirements. This includes clauses related to data encryption.
4 Implement robust security protocols: In addition to the offshoring provider's security measures, companies should also implement their own security protocols to protect data. This includes using secure communication channels.
5 Monitor and audit security: Regularly monitor and audit the offshoring provider's security measures to ensure they are effective. This includes conducting on-site audits.
6 Foster effective communication: Having clear communication channels with the offshoring provider is essential in ensuring data security. This includes training staff on security protocols.
7 Prepare for data breach: In the event of a data breach, companies must be prepared to respond quickly and effectively. This includes having a crisis plan in place that outlines procedures for protecting against breaches.

9 Regularly review and update security measures: Data security is an ongoing process that requires continuous review and improvement. Regularly assess and update data security policies, procedures, and protocols to ensure they remain effective and up-to-date with the latest threats and regulations.
In conclusion, offshoring can be a cost-effective and efficient way for companies to achieve their business goals, but it also comes with significant data security risks. By following these steps, companies can ensure that their data is protected and their clients' trust is maintained. The key to successful data security in offshoring is a combination of proactive measures, robust security protocols, clear communication channels, and ongoing risk assessment and mitigation.
